Optimizing for Mobile and Fast-Scrolling Feeds

Designing for mobile requires a keen eye for detail. Small screens demand fonts that are crisp and clear. Nahla Script excels here due to its clean lines and open counters (the enclosed spaces within letters like 'e' or 'a'). When designing for dark backgrounds, the high contrast of the brush strokes remains sharp. On light backgrounds, the font maintains its elegance without appearing washed out. This adaptability ensures that your campaign visuals look professional whether viewed on a desktop monitor or a smartphone screen.

Strategic Font Pairing and Hierarchy

No single font can do everything. To maximize the impact of Nahla Script, strategic font pairing is essential. We found that pairing Nahla with a clean, geometric sans serif created a stunning contrast. The sans serif handles the body text and detailed information, providing stability and readability, while Nahla takes center stage for headlines and callouts.

This combination leverages the strengths of both typefaces. The sans serif grounds the design, preventing the script from becoming too whimsical or difficult to read over long periods. Meanwhile, Nahla injects personality and movement, preventing the layout from feeling static. This hierarchy ensures that the most important messages—like sale dates, product names, or event titles—are instantly recognizable.

For those looking to experiment, Nahla also pairs well with modern serif fonts for a more editorial or luxurious feel. This is particularly effective for high-end product launches or luxury brand campaigns. The key is to maintain balance: let Nahla shine as the display font, and keep supporting typography simple and unobtrusive.
